`
standalone
  • 浏览: 609712 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

show git branch in your bash prompt

阅读更多
export PS1='\[\e[1;0m\][\[\e[38;5;174m\]\u\[\e[38;5;240m\]@\[\e[01;32m\]\h\[\e[38;5;222m\] \w\[\e[31m\]$(parse_git_branch "(%s)")\[\e[1;0m\]]\[\e[38;5;240m\]\$\[\e[1;0m\]\e[m'

function parse_git_branch {
    ref=$(git-symbolic-ref HEAD 2> /dev/null) || return
    echo "("${ref#refs/heads/}")"
}
分享到:
评论

相关推荐

    .git-completion.bash

    .git-completion.bash

    学习git和gitbash使用的一些详细操作

    接下来我们将详细解释Git及其命令行工具GitBash的使用。 首先,我们需要了解Git的一些基本概念: 1. 工作区(Working Directory):实际的文件存放的位置,即你在电脑上看到的目录。 2. 暂存区(Staging Area 或 ...

    git-completion.bash

    git是一种版本管理,强大之处毋庸置疑,但mac用户在配置好git环境后,发现我们无法使用table按键来进行补全,我猜你们是缺少这个文件

    git-bash.exe

    git-bash.exe

    GitBash windows 64位版本

    GitBash是一款在Windows操作系统上运行的命令行工具,它为用户提供了类Unix shell环境,以便于使用Git进行版本控制。GitBash包含了Git的所有功能,并且还包含了其他Unix工具,如bash shell、grep、sed、awk等,使得...

    GitBash和GitGui右键失效解决方法

    2.给gitbash 添加图片: 选中 Git Bash Here,右键新建(字符串值),并重命名为Icon,Icon的值设置为D:\Program Files\Git\mingw64\share\git\git-for-windows.ico 3.选中 Git Bash Here 右键新建(项),并重命名...

    linux-bashgitprompt一个针对Git用户的多信息的和花俏的bash命令提示符

    "bash-git-prompt"项目正是一款专为Git用户设计的多功能、炫酷的Bash命令提示符工具。下面将详细介绍这个工具及其功能,以及如何在你的Linux环境中安装和使用。 **bash-git-prompt简介** bash-git-prompt是一个开源...

    让bash下git命令自动完成的文件

    下载本附件,放到你的用户主目录,在你的....if [ -f ~/.git-completion.bash ]; then . ~/.git-completion.bash fi 然后source一下或者重新登录,你的git就支持自动补完了,输入 git com,然后按两次tab键,即见效。

    Git Bash.zip

    通过Git Bash,Windows用户可以在熟悉的命令行界面下使用Git的所有功能,包括克隆(clone)、拉取(pull)、推送(push)、提交(commit)、分支(branch)操作等。 关于GitHub,它是全球最大的开源软件托管平台,...

    git branch基本使用

    讲述了git分支的使用,创建分支,修改分支,删除分支,克隆分支

    Git Bash.rar|Git Bash.rar

    Git Bash是一款在Windows操作系统上运行的命令行工具,它提供了与GNU/Linux或Unix系统类似的环境,使得用户可以在Windows上方便地使用Git版本控制系统。Git Bash是Git for Windows的一部分,允许开发者在Windows环境...

    tmux-git, 在Tmux状态栏中,显示当前 git branch的脚本.zip

    tmux-git, 在Tmux状态栏中,显示当前 git branch的脚本 Tmux中的 git-branch tmux-git 在 tmux 状态栏中显示当前目录的git repo 信息,如当前分支。dirtiness 。存储等等。概述在你的Linux终端提示符( 就像我在这里...

    Git Bash windows 64 git2.16.2

    标签"git,gitbash"分别代表了Git版本控制系统本身和其在Windows上的命令行接口Git Bash。Git是通过命令行进行操作的,而Git Bash在Windows上提供了与Unix/Linux类似的命令行环境,包括常用的shell命令和Git命令,如`...

    Git Bash常用命令与解释

    Git Bash是一款在Windows环境下模拟Unix/Linux命令行工具的软件,它允许用户在Windows系统中使用Git和其他基于Unix的命令行工具。Git Bash是Git的一部分,Git是一个强大的分布式版本控制系统,用于跟踪对文件和项目...

    SSH in GitBash & TortoiseGit.pdf

    SSH in GitBash & TortoiseGit.pdf SSH in GitBash & TortoiseGit.pdf SSH in GitBash & TortoiseGit.pdf

    mac环境下的git命令行工具

    git命令行工具,gitbash,mac环境使用,直接安装即可 git命令行工具,gitbash,mac环境使用,直接安装即可

    Git Bash exe安装资源

    Git Bash是Windows环境下使用Git命令行工具的一种方式,它提供了类似于Linux或Unix系统的命令行环境,使得在Windows上可以方便地使用Git进行版本控制。Git Bash包含了一个完整的GNU工具链,包括bash shell、gcc...

    Gitbash-2.22.rar

    "Gitbash-2.22.rar"这个压缩包包含了Git Bash的最新版本,即2.22-64位版本,分为安装版(Git-2.22.0-64-bit.exe)和移动版(PortableGit-2.22.0-64-bit.7z.exe)。 1. **Git介绍**:Git是一款分布式版本控制系统,...

Global site tag (gtag.js) - Google Analytics